I purchased this book only becuse Jennifer now works at my company. I wanted to know what her thoughts on web navigation were.

I have used most of the methods in this book even before reading it. There are things I hadn't considered that after reading this book will assist me in creating the most easily navigateable sites on the web.

Very insightful, very well written, an absolute must for anyone involved in any part of web site development, from inception to deployment.

A must have.
